Ingredients (Original Text):

Tomato puree (water, tomato paste), fresh onions, spinach, diced tomatoes in tomato juice, sugar, canola oil, contains less than 1% of: salt, parmesan cheese (part-skim milk, cultures, salt, enzymes), dehydrated roasted garlic, granular and parmesan cheese (milk, cultures, salt, enzymes), citric acid, spice, dehydrated garlic, flavoring, lactic acid.
